Women Equality Day:Army organized lecture cum workshop

Lolab:August 27:  In consonance with its continuous efforts, Army Camp Gujjarpatti in collaboration with Jan Sikshan Sansthan, Kupwara organised lecture cum workshop for local women on the occassion of Women Equality Day 2021 in VTC, Chandigam, Lolab valley. This is also called gender equality day as it observes equal rights for both genders. For years, women faced stigma, stereotypes, and violence. Women Equality day calls for an equal future free of discrimination based on gender and gives them equal rights and opportunities.

The aim of conducting this lecture cum workshop was to empower women by bringing awareness amongst them about Jan Shikshan Sansthan and to give them a hope that they too can make laurels for themselves and the society. During the entire session due COVID protocols were strictly followed.

A total of 26 women and 17 men witnessed the lecture. A team from JSS, Kupwara consisting of 03 female instructors and 01 Male instructor intially congratulated every women folk on the occassion of Gender equality day and empowered women by giving a brief talk about the role of women as a mother, daughter, wife and working women in today’s society quoting some exemplary examples. Following this a workshop for the women present there was conducted by team JSS, in which they were briefed about Courses offered, grant of certificates, grant of loan to open small businesses, production faculty etc.

In the end, masks were distributed by Lolab lions to all women and men folk present there. The women folk for empowering them on this auspicious day appreciated the efforts of the Indian Army and conveyed their gratitude for the same.
